TUI China
In May 2011 the national tourism authority of China (CNTA) granted TUI China Travel Co. Ltd. an outbound licence that entitles the company to organise trips abroad for Chinese holidaymakers. TUI China is just one of three foreign companies and the only European tour operator to have been granted this licence.
"Recognising the market’s growth potential, we have invested in China and positioned the TUI brand early on. Our strategy has clearly been validated by the granting of the ‘outbound’ licence,” said TUI AG CEO Michael Frenzel. Prior to receiving the new licence, TUI China has focused on the inbound Chinese travel market. With the new license for international travel, TUI China will be able to further exploit the potential of the fast-growing Chinese tourism market.
TUI Russia & CIS
In 2010 TUI Russia & CIS started up business displaying the TUI brand in Russia and the Ukraine. The company is a joint venture between TUI Travel PLC and the Russian investment firm S-Group Capital Management. Applying the new brand concept TUI Russia & CIS intends to reach the top spot in the areas of customer service, best practice and product & experience offerings.
TUI Russia & CIS has been on the market since 15 April 2009. Part of the brand are the Russian companies VKO Group and Mostravel as well as the Ukrainian company Voyage Kiev, which every year sends over half a million customers to more than 20 holiday destinations. The joint venture runs more than 200 of it own and franchise travel agencies and employs over 1500 people. The primary goal of TUI Russia & CIS is to set up a tourism company in Russia and the CIS.
